#tabla_registro, #registro_completado, #datos_actualizados,#cliente_registrado.cliente2 {
    color: #FFF !important;
    background: none !important;
    border: thin solid #CCC !important;
	 
}
#mensaje_guardado{

background:#3C0;
border:solid 1px #3C0;
color:#FFF;
padding:10px;
text-align:center;
font-size:1.2em;
width:50%;

margin:auto;	
}
#registro_completado{
	margin-top:10%;
}
.alerta_registro{
color:#F00 !important;	
}
#tabla_registro INPUT[type="text"]{
	   width: 80% !important;
	       
}
#tabla_registro INPUT[type="button"]{
	   width: initial !important;
	       
}
.campo_formulario,.area_formulario,.select_formulario{
	font-size: 1em;
    font-family: IMPORT-REGULAR;
    padding: 1%;
    font-size: 1em;
    margin: 5px 0;
    color: #CCC;
    display: table;
    width: 98%;
	
}
.fecha_picker{
	    cursor: pointer;
    width: 6em;
    color: #FFF;
    border: solid 1px #999;
    background: #CCC;
}
.fecha_picker:hover{
	background: #e0e0e0;
	 border: solid 1px #CCC;

}
.area_formulario{
	color: #CCC;
}

#formulario{
	   /* margin: 20px 0;*/
    transition: 0.5s;
    height: auto;
    width: 50%;
    float: left;
    margin-right: 20px;

	
	
}
#formulario.cerrado{

	display:initial;
	height:0px;
	
	  
	
}
#container_gestor{
	       width: 47%;
    float: left;
    height: 351px;
    overflow-y: auto;
    overflow-x: hidden;
}

.campo_formulario.cerrado,.area_formulario.cerrado,.select_formulario.cerrado,input.cerrado,textarea.cerrado,form#upload.cerrado,form#upload.cerrado input,select.cerrado{
	/*height:0px;
	margin:0px;
	padding:0px;
	font-size:0;
	border:0;
	transition:0.5s;*/
	
}
#formulario input[type="button"]{
    margin-bottom: 10px;
	font-size:1em;
}

.select_formulario{
	width: initial;
	color: #000;
}
.error_formulario{
	font-size:0.8em;
	color:#F00;
	transition:0.5s;
}
#imagen_upload{
width: 150px;
    height: 150px;
    border: solid 1px #CCC;
    margin: 0 20px 20px 0;
    float: left;
    background-size: cover !important;
    background-position: center;
    background-repeat: no-repeat;
}
#formulario.editando input[type="text"],#formulario.editando input[type="number"],#formulario.editando textarea{
border-color: #b3c267;
    background: #b2c7b5;
    color: #FFF !important;
}
#formulario.editando  #fecha {
	background: #619661;
    color: #FFF !important;
    border: solid #5ec75e 1px;
}

/*UPLOADER SIMPLE*/
#uploader_simple{
	display: table;
    width: 100%;
}
#uploader_simple #boton_sube{
	    float: none;
    margin: auto;
    display: table;
}
#uploader_simple #nombre_archivo{
    
	    text-align: center;
    padding: 20px 0;
    font-size: 0.9em;
    color: #999;
}



/*FIN UPLOADER SIMPLE*/


@media (max-width: 850px) {
	#formulario,#container_gestor{
		width:100%;	
	}
	a.carga.boton{
		width:initial !important;	
	}
	
}